We are looking for a Meetings and Events Sales Agent to join our team, where you'll play a crucial role in managing event bookings, maximising revenue, and providing outstanding guest service. You will often be the first point of contact with our guests - taking them from first enquiry through to contracting. You will need to be comfortable engaging with guests on the phone, via email and face to face in the hotel.

We offer Meeting and Events in all shapes and sizes - from 2 to 100 guests, business meetings through to weddings and private events. This role is predominantly office based in the hotel, working Monday to Friday, mainly dealing with direct enquiries although in time there will be the option to expand into direct sales calls as the business needs.

If you are looking for career training we offer nationally recognized apprenticeships which sit alongside our detailed brand development.

What you'll be doing as Meetings and Events Agent

  • Top quality customer service
  • Working as part of a dynamic and supportive team.
  • Take enquiries and bookings via telephone and online bookings
  • Processing, amending and updating bookings as required
  • Hotel tours for new and prospective guests
  • Develop lasting relationships with clients and generate repeat business
  • Maximising revenue through upselling - this could be food and beverage packages, accommodation bookings and meeting room hire
  • Administration and Technology savvy - Opera, Salesforce
